Rare antique (1800?s; warranty label handnumbered as 355) fruitwood Virgil Practice Clavier made as piano with fully-weighted keys for fingering skills practice ? by design, no tones were meant to be audible except lever-adjustable clicks. Directions/warranty labels intact; 50-key; C to C (7 octaves); 50?x20?x9?+24? legs which can fold up beneath the piano body for placement on furniture or table, if desired. Nice display and good for ?noiseless practice? by young and old. Fully functional. Known restoration issues: kind repair to leg-spacer mid-brace, reseating top cover hinges, and a few key plates re-glued. See pictures.
